Current UPSC Job Openings:
- Indian Military Academy, Dehradun – 163rd (DE) Course commencing in July 2027 – 100 [including 13 vacancies reserved for NCC `C’ Certificate (Army Wing) holders]
- Indian Naval Academy, Ezhimala – Course commencing in July, 2027 Executive Branch (General Service)/Hydro – 26 [including 06 vacancies for NCC ‘C’ Certificate (Naval Wing) holders and 01 for Hydro]
- Air Force Academy, Hyderabad – (Pre-Flying) Training Course commencing in July, 2027 i.e. 222 F(P) Course – 32 [including 03 vacancies reserved for NCC ‘C’ Certificate (Air Wing) holders through NCC Special Entry]
- Officers’ Training Academy, Chennai (Madras) 126th SSC (Men) (NT) (UPSC) Course Commencing in October, 2027 – 275 vacancies
- Officers’ Training Academy, Chennai (Madras) 126th SSC Women (NT) (UPSC) Course commencing in October, 2027 – 18 vacancies
UPSC Eligibility Criteria:
Educational Qualification for UPSC:
- For I.M.A. and Officers’ Training Academy (OTA), Chennai – Degree of a recognised University or equivalent.
- For Indian Naval Academy – A degree in Engineering or B.Sc. with Physics as core or elective subject from recognised University/ Institution (with Physics and Mathematics in 10+2 level).
- For Air Force Academy – Degree of a recognised University (with Physics and Mathematics at 10+2 level) or Bachelor of Engineering.
Age Limit for UPSC:
- For IMA – Age: 19 to 24 years. Unmarried male candidates born not earlier than 1st July, 2003 and not later than 1st July, 2008 only are eligible.
- For Indian Naval Academy – Age: 19 to 24 years. Unmarried male candidates born not earlier than 1st July, 2003 and not later than 1st July, 2008 only are eligible.
- For Air Force Academy – Age: 20 to 24 years as on 1st July, 2027 i.e. born not earlier than 1st July, 2003 and not later than 1st July, 2007. Upper age limit for candidates holding valid and current Commercial Pilot Licence issued by DGCA (India) is relaxable upto 26 yrs. i.e. born not earlier than 1st July, 2001 and not later than 1st July, 2007 only are eligible. Note: Candidate below 25 years of age must be unmarried. Marriage is not permitted during training. Married candidates aged 25 years or above are eligible to apply but during training period they will neither be provided married accommodation nor can they live with family out of the premises.
- For Officers’ Training Academy (SSC Course for men) – Age: 19 to 25 years. Unmarried male candidate born not earlier than 1st July 2002 and not later than 1st July, 2008 only are eligible.
- For Officers’ Training Academy (SSC Women Non-Technical Course) – Age: 19 to 25 years. Unmarried women, issueless widows who have not remarried and issueless divorcees (in possession of divorce documents) who have not remarried are eligible. They should have been born not earlier than 1st July, 2002 and not later than 1st July, 2008.
